Output 17f3e298114daf9dc5880c0d85a09cc298c5449a8585bbb1c25513f441bdcf84:108

value
53320
script pubkey
OP_0 OP_PUSHBYTES_20 c906d95c404c1730e18b1c4f0c3a7959836e0047
address
bc1qeyrdjhzqfstnpcvtr38scwnetxpkuqz8c7mf82
transaction
17f3e298114daf9dc5880c0d85a09cc298c5449a8585bbb1c25513f441bdcf84
confirmations
150742
spent
true